Department Statement:
University Registrar Services develops and maintains registration and academic records for the University, consistently applying a commitment to accuracy, integrity, and confidentiality. Our primary goal is to promote quality by exceeding the expectations of our customers, as we assist students, prospective students, parents, alumni, faculty, staff, and the community. Through an array of diversified functions, innovative technology, and focused data reporting, University Registrar Services actively supports the colleges/schools in the advancement of the University's goals for service, teaching, retention, and graduation. ASU Statement:
Arizona State University is a new model for American higher education, an unprecedented combination of academic excellence, entrepreneurial energy and broad access. This New American University is a single, unified institution comprising four differentiated campuses positively impacting the economic, social, cultural and environmental health of the communities it serves. Its research is inspired by real world application blurring the boundaries that traditionally separate academic disciplines. ASU serves more than 100,000 students in metropolitan Phoenix, Arizona, the nation's fifth largest city. ASU champions inclusive excellence, and welcomes students from all fifty states and more than one hundred nations across the globe.
